Loaded Bacon Cheeseburger Alfredo Pasta

A cozy and satisfying dish featuring creamy cheese sauce, crispy bacon, and hearty pasta, perfect for busy weeknights or family gatherings.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 35 minutes
Course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ine American
Servings 6 servings
Calories 650 kcal

Ingredients
  

Pasta and Meats

  • 12 oz pasta of your choice (preferably fettuccine or penne)
  • 1 lb ground beef
  • 8 slices bacon, chopped Cook until crispy

Vegetables

  • 1 small onion, finely ch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ced

Sauce Ingredients

  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1.5 cups beef broth
  • 1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 tbsp tomato paste
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ley, chopped for garnish Optional
  • Red pepper flakes for a bit of heat (optional)

Instructions
 

Cooking the Pasta

  • Cook the pasta in a large pot of salted boiling water until al dente according to the package instructions. Drain and set aside.

Preparing the Sauce

  • In a large skillet, cook chopped bacon over medium heat until crispy. Remove the bacon from the skillet and set it on a paper towel-lined plate. Discard excess bacon fat, leaving about 1 tablespoon in the skillet.
  • In the same skillet, add olive oil and sauté onion until soft and translucent. Add minced gar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ant.
  • Add ground beef to the skillet and cook until browned, breaking it up into smaller pieces as it cooks. Drain excess fat if necessary.
  • Stir in tomato paste and Worcestershire sauce, mixing well to combine with the beef.
  • Pour in beef broth and bring to a simmer. Let it cook for about 5 minutes to allow the flavors to meld together.
  • Reduce the heat to low, then add the heavy cream. Stir in Parmesan cheese until melted and smooth.
  • Add the shredded cheddar cheese a handful at a time, stirring until each addition is melted and the sauce is creamy and thick.
  • Season with salt, pepper, and a pinch of red pepper flakes if using.

Combining

  • Combine the cooked pasta and crispy bacon with the sauce, tossing until well coated.
  • Serve immediately, garnished with chopped parsley.

Notes

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Freeze in a freezer-safe container for up to 3 months. Reheat with a splash of milk or cream to restore creaminess.
